Output 8e667fd8f969bcf75334263530871999b0ce15b1f563c75e0b95a18f9af7c99b:25

value
72620
script pubkey
OP_0 OP_PUSHBYTES_20 c38538ab93fc1e7d677cd2791b3b071facee0bb3
address
bc1qcwzn32unls086emu6fu3kwc8r7kwuzanp5per6
transaction
8e667fd8f969bcf75334263530871999b0ce15b1f563c75e0b95a18f9af7c99b
confirmations
184811
spent
true